ALC墙板专用薄层砌筑砂浆的制备及性能研究

    摘要:研究了可再分散乳胶粉、纤维素醚、消泡剂和硼酸掺量对ALC墙板专用薄层砌筑砂浆性能的影响。结果表明:纤维素醚的掺入可显著增大薄层砌筑砂浆的保水率,但对28 d抗压强度有较大负面影响;相比于纤维素醚,可再分散乳胶粉更能显著提高薄层砌筑砂浆的粘结性能,当可再分散乳胶粉掺量为0.8%时,14 d拉伸粘结强度为对照组的4.5倍;消泡剂与纤维素醚复掺时,能在一定程度上减小抗压强度的降幅。

Study on preparation and properties of special thin layer masonry mortar for ALC wallboard

    Abstract:Effects of redispersible latex powder,cellulose ether,defoamer and boric acid on properties of thin-layer masonry mortar for ALC wallboard were studied. The results show that the incorporation of cellulose ether can significantly increase the water retention of thin layer mortar,but has a great negative effect on the 28 d compressive strength. Compared with cellulose ether,the redispersible latex powder can significantly improve the bond performance of thin layer mortar. When the rubber powder content is 0.8%,the 14 d tensile bond strength is 4.5 times of the blank group. When defoaming agent is mixed with cellulose ether,the reduction of compressive strength can be slowed down to a certain extent.
